I also have endometriosis and hEDS & currently have the mirena iud for endo treatment & bc. I will disclaim, the excruciating pain following the insertion, even with a cervical block, is unlike any I’ve experienced before, and persisted a whole day. I previously had an iud inserted years before when I wasn’t having endo symptoms yet & that insertion was manageable with some cramping, & I didn’t have a cervical block for that one. I seem to develop more cysts on my ovaries with the iud, which my doctor did say was a possibility. The cysts resolve themselves, but sometimes cause pain. hEDS-wise, I’ve also noticed I subluxate joints more easily. A few weeks ago I subluxated a rib sneezing too hard, and I’m still dealing with the aftermath to my muscles. Honestly, I haven’t noticed much of a difference in my endo pain. Maybe it’s slightly less frequent?One positive is I don’t have a period, so if your endo gets worse on your period, that may be a benefit. I’ve also used the Zafemy patch, which I don’t recommend. It doesn’t stay on, caused acne breakouts, & did nothing for endo symptoms.

As someone who was told I would grow out of it for most of my life, no. In my experience I don’t think it’s something to grow out of and it has in fact, gotten much worse as I’ve aged. For context I started having symptoms around age 10 and am now 22. However, coexisting conditions can exacerbate or change what symptoms present. I can only speak as someone with dysautonomia and hypermobile ehlers-danlos syndrome (& long list of other conditions). For someone with a different type of POTS/dysautonomia, maybe it is possible to grow out of. At least I hope it is, as I don’t wish a lifetime of suffering from the condition on anyone.
